In the early 1800s, Prussian geographer Alexander Von Humboldt and French botanist Aimé Bonpland launch an expedition to explore the Amazon region, including the Orinoco River, from Venezuela to the border of Portuguese Brazil.


Main Cast: Roy Dupuis, Christian Vadim

Director: Luis Armando Roche

Writers: Jacques Espagne, Luis Armando Roche
